The Department of Materials Science and Engineering at Pennsylvania State University is seeking a Postdoctoral Scholar to conduct fundamental research in the areas of experimental ceramic and energy conversion materials research. This position requires extensive experience in the areas of energy conversion materials synthesis and device fabrication/testing. These experiences will be evaluated based upon prior research experience and peer-reviewed high impact factor journal publications. Prior research experience in materials characterization, testbed development, etc. will be beneficial. Priorities will be given to the candidates who have experience in various fabrication techniques such as tape casting, additive manufacturing etc. Further, the candidate should have experience with microstructure analysis via high-resolution microscopies. The candidate will be actively collaborating with multiple academic and industry team members and thus good communication skills are desired. The candidate is expected to participate in the development of project reports and proposals, and thus good technical writing skills are highly desired. The final candidate will work on fabrication and characterization of various functional ceramics and energy conversion materials.
